Re: Corrosion in bulkhead stiffeners
Hi Kimball, I would agree scotch brite is a great corrosion cleaner especially the little roloc pads you can use on an small pnewmatic angle grinder. The roloc pads are about 1.5 inch diameter. I like the dupont vari-prime which in a spot like that you can just brush it on. My airplane also had a ca...

Control Cables
I've been replacing mine a few at a time. I would recommend changing the flaps and ailerons at the same time if you choose to do it that way. I changed my aileron cables a couple years ago and wish I had done the flaps at the same time because they run on the same ganged pulleys. Anyway I now have a...
